Inquiry-based learning (IBL) is a powerful educational approach that fosters curiosity, engagement, and critical thinking skills among learners. Rooted in the principle of exploration and discovery, IBL encourages students to ask questions, seek answers, and construct their understanding of the world. In this blog, we’ll explore the significance of promoting critical thinking through inquiry-based learning and how educators can effectively implement this approach in their teaching practices.

Understanding Inquiry-Based Learning: At its core, inquiry-based learning revolves around posing questions, investigating problems, and developing solutions. Unlike traditional lecture-based instruction, where information is primarily transmitted from teacher to student, IBL shifts the focus to student-centered exploration. Instead of providing all the answers, educators act as facilitators, guiding students through the process of inquiry and discovery.

Key Components of Inquiry-Based Learning:

  1. Questioning: Inquiry begins with questions. Encouraging students to ask open-ended questions sparks curiosity and drives exploration. These questions serve as the foundation for inquiry, guiding students’ research and investigation.
  2. Investigation: Inquiry-based learning involves hands-on exploration and experimentation. Students actively seek answers to their questions through research, observation, data collection, and analysis. This process promotes a deeper understanding of concepts and principles.
  3. Collaboration: Collaboration plays a vital role in inquiry-based learning. Students often work in groups, sharing ideas, insights, and resources. Collaborative inquiry encourages peer learning, communication skills, and the exchange of diverse perspectives.
  4. Reflection: Reflection is an essential component of the inquiry process. Students reflect on their findings, evaluate their methods, and consider alternative perspectives. Reflective practices promote metacognition and help students refine their critical thinking skills.

Promoting Critical Thinking Through IBL:

  1. Encouraging Curiosity: Inquiry-based learning cultivates curiosity by encouraging students to explore topics of interest and ask meaningful questions. By nurturing curiosity, educators spark students’ intrinsic motivation to learn and engage critically with content.
  2. Developing Analytical Skills: Through hands-on investigation and analysis, students develop essential analytical skills. They learn to gather and evaluate information, identify patterns, and draw evidence-based conclusions. These analytical skills are critical for solving complex problems and making informed decisions.
  3. Fostering Creativity: IBL encourages creative thinking by empowering students to explore unconventional solutions and think outside the box. By embracing experimentation and innovation, students develop the confidence to explore new ideas and approaches.
  4. Building Resilience: Inquiry-based learning promotes resilience by challenging students to overcome obstacles and persevere in the face of uncertainty. As they encounter setbacks and unexpected results, students learn to adapt their strategies, revise their hypotheses, and persist in their inquiry.
  5. Cultivating Metacognition: Through reflection and self-assessment, students develop metacognitive awareness—the ability to monitor, evaluate, and regulate their thinking processes. Metacognition enhances students’ ability to think critically about their learning, identify areas for improvement, and make strategic adjustments.

Effective Implementation Strategies:

  1. Designing Engaging Inquiry Tasks: Develop inquiry tasks that are relevant, authentic, and aligned with students’ interests and learning goals. Provide opportunities for open-ended exploration and hands-on experimentation.
  2. Scaffold Inquiry Process: Scaffold the inquiry process by providing guidance and support at each stage. Model questioning techniques, demonstrate research strategies, and offer feedback to help students navigate their inquiries effectively.
  3. Foster a Supportive Learning Environment: Create a supportive learning environment where students feel safe to take risks, ask questions, and explore new ideas. Encourage collaboration, celebrate diversity, and promote a growth mindset that values effort and perseverance.
  4. Integrate Technology and Resources: Utilize technology and digital resources to enhance inquiry-based learning experiences. Provide access to online databases, virtual simulations, and multimedia resources that enrich students’ investigations and broaden their perspectives.
